var packet = require('dns-packet')
var dgram = require('dgram')
var thunky = require('thunky')
var events = require('events')
var os = require('os')
var noop = function () {}
module.exports = function (opts) {
if (!opts) opts = {}
var that = new events.EventEmitter()
var port = typeof opts.port === 'number' ? opts.port : 5353
var type = opts.type || 'udp4'
var ip = opts.ip || opts.host || (type === 'udp4' ? '224.0.0.251' : null)
var me = {address: ip, port: port}
var memberships = {}
var destroyed = false
var interval = null
if (type === 'udp6' && (!ip || !opts.interface)) {
throw new Error('For IPv6 multicast you must specify `ip` and `interface`')
}
var socket = opts.socket || dgram.createSocket({
type: type,
reuseAddr: opts.reuseAddr !== false,
toString: function () {
return type
}
})
socket.on('error', function (err) {
if (err.code === 'EACCES' || err.code === 'EADDRINUSE') that.emit('error', err)
else that.emit('warning', err)
})
socket.on('message', function (message, rinfo) {
try {
message = packet.decode(message)
} catch (err) {
that.emit('warning', err)
return
}
that.emit('packet', message, rinfo)
if (message.type === 'query') that.emit('query', message, rinfo)
if (message.type === 'response') that.emit('response', message, rinfo)
})
socket.on('listening', function () {
if (!port) port = me.port = socket.address().port
if (opts.multicast !== false) {
that.update()
interval = setInterval(that.update, 5000)
socket.setMulticastTTL(opts.ttl || 255)
socket.setMulticastLoopback(opts.loopback !== false)
}
})
var bind = thunky(function (cb) {
if (!port) return cb(null)
socket.once('error', cb)
socket.bind(port, opts.interface, function () {
socket.removeListener('error', cb)
cb(null)
})
})
bind(function (err) {
if (err) return that.emit('error', err)
that.emit('ready')
})
that.send = function (value, rinfo, cb) {
if (typeof rinfo === 'function') return that.send(value, null, rinfo)
if (!cb) cb = noop
if (!rinfo) rinfo = me
bind(onbind)
function onbind (err) {
if (destroyed) return cb()
if (err) return cb(err)
var message = packet.encode(value)
socket.send(message, 0, message.length, rinfo.port, rinfo.address || rinfo.host, cb)
}
}
that.response =
that.respond = function (res, rinfo, cb) {
if (Array.isArray(res)) res = {answers: res}
res.type = 'response'
res.flags = (res.flags || 0) | packet.AUTHORITATIVE_ANSWER
that.send(res, rinfo, cb)
}
that.query = function (q, type, rinfo, cb) {
if (typeof type === 'function') return that.query(q, null, null, type)
if (typeof type === 'object' && type && type.port) return that.query(q, null, type, rinfo)
if (typeof rinfo === 'function') return that.query(q, type, null, rinfo)
if (!cb) cb = noop
if (typeof q === 'string') q = [{name: q, type: type || 'ANY'}]
if (Array.isArray(q)) q = {type: 'query', questions: q}
q.type = 'query'
that.send(q, rinfo, cb)
}
that.destroy = function (cb) {
if (!cb) cb = noop
if (destroyed) return process.nextTick(cb)
destroyed = true
clearInterval(interval)
socket.once('close', cb)
socket.close()
}
that.update = function () {
var ifaces = opts.interface ? [].concat(opts.interface) : allInterfaces()
var updated = false
for (var i = 0; i < ifaces.length; i++) {
var addr = ifaces[i]
if (memberships[addr]) continue
memberships[addr] = true
updated = true
try {
socket.addMembership(ip, addr)
} catch (err) {
that.emit('warning', err)
}
}
if (!updated || !socket.setMulticastInterface) return
socket.setMulticastInterface(opts.interface || defaultInterface())
}
return that
}
function defaultInterface () {
var networks = os.networkInterfaces()
var names = Object.keys(networks)
for (var i = 0; i < names.length; i++) {
var net = networks[names[i]]
for (var j = 0; j < net.length; j++) {
var iface = net[j]
if (iface.family === 'IPv4' && !iface.internal) return iface.address
}
}
return '127.0.0.1'
}
function allInterfaces () {
var networks = os.networkInterfaces()
var names = Object.keys(networks)
var res = []
for (var i = 0; i < names.length; i++) {
var net = networks[names[i]]
for (var j = 0; j < net.length; j++) {
var iface = net[j]
if (iface.family === 'IPv4') {
res.push(iface.address)
// could only addMembership once per interface (https://nodejs.org/api/dgram.html#dgram_socket_addmembership_multicastaddress_multicastinterface)
break
}
}
}
return res
}
